Output 342835a89a3025d51a777ec714be37ed9945c09d1a0bc04df4f7f66b50510426:2

value
2181143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d1f76026699dd8a98be743127817698866c4052 OP_EQUAL
address
32tQPz3cz4AnqZbVR7KJW2pZLF8rGzz457
transaction
342835a89a3025d51a777ec714be37ed9945c09d1a0bc04df4f7f66b50510426